GW Medical Community members inducted as Fellows in the American College of Radiology

Dr. Esma Akin posing for a portrait

GW Faculty member Esma A. Akin, M.D., and alumnus Roger S. Eng, Jr., M.D. '91, M.P.H. ‘92, have been inducted as Fellows in the American College of Radiology (ACR). Akin, who is an associate professor of radiology at the George Washington University School of Medicine and Health Sciences and chief of nuclear medicine at the GW Medical Faculty Associates, received her medical degree from Hacettepe University School of Medicine in Ankara, Turkey. Eng is chief of radiology at the Chinese Hospital in San Francisco and president of the Golden Gate Radiology Medical Group. This is one of the highest honors bestowed by the ACR, a national non-profit association serving more than 34,000 radiologists, radiation oncologists, interventional radiologists, nuclear medicine physicians and medical physicists. The induction took place April 22 during the 89th ACR Annual Meeting and Chapter Leadership conference in Washington, D.C.
